PowerSchool & Schoology

The district has used Google Classroom for the last few years to share documents and classroom assignments between teachers and students. Last spring, the district made the decision to adopt Schoology, a full learning management system, which will allow for greater collaboration between teachers and students and communication with co-curricular groups and families.

While a learning management system has been a long-term goal, why are we doing this now?

The pandemic has shown the limitations of Google Classroom.

The rollout of Schoology will continue over the next few months. Teachers had an initial training this summer and will spend time getting comfortable with it this fall. Parents and guardians will be invited after the first trimester.

PowerSchool is still the resource for grade information. If you haven’t set up your account for the PowerSchool Parent Portal, please contact the main office at your child’s school.

Mask Status

Today, Hudson has 57 COVID cases. It has gone up as high as 74 before coming back down.

The NH Department of Health & Human Services releases COVID data late in the day, Monday through Friday. If I’m going to change the status of masks, that change will most likely happen late Monday and it will be emailed to you directly. I do not plan to switch mask status either way if cases hover right around 50.
